Stoeneşti, Vâlcea, Romania

Overview

Stoeneşti is a peaceful, picturesque commune set in the rolling hills of Vâlcea County, Romania. With a small but welcoming population, the town offers an authentic taste of rural Romanian culture set in beautiful natural surroundings. It's perfect for travelers seeking tranquility, local traditions, and outdoor recreation.

Best Time to Visit

May to September for warm weather and lush landscapes

Local Tips

Cash is preferred in most local shops and cafes; basic Romanian phrases are helpful as English is limited. Public transport is minimal, so arrange private transport or a rental car in advance.

Cultural Etiquette

Tipping is customary (5-10% in cafes or restaurants). Dress modestly, especially when visiting churches. Greet locals with a friendly 'Bună ziua' (Good day) and respect traditional customs.

Safety Warnings

Stoeneşti is very safe with little crime. Care should be taken when exploring rural roads, especially in winter, as they may be narrow or unpaved. Beware of stray dogs in outlying areas.

Hidden Gems

Visit the hidden forest trails around Bârlogu, explore local orchard farms in Piscul Mare, and seek out small, historic wooden churches scattered across the commune.
